Description
These zucchini pizza bites are a tasty way to eat your vegetables! These are kid-friendly, easy to make, and a healthy way to satisfy your pizza cravings!
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 large or 2 small zucchini (about 8 ounces)
- 1/2 cup your favorite marinara sauce
- 1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 6 basil leaves, turn into small pieces
- Shredded parmesan cheese for topping (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ees.
- Using a mandoline or sharp knife, slice the zucchini into 1/2″ thick rounds
- Lay on a paper towel and sprinkle with salt. Let sit for a few minutes and dab with the paper towel to remove the moisture.
- Spray a large baking sheet with non-stick spray, or lay down a sheet of parchment paper, then arrange the zucchini in a single layer.
- Top with a spoonful of sauce and a pinch of cheese.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es or until the cheese begins to brown.
- Sprinkle with fresh basil and parmesan and serve!
Notes
When picking out zucchini, look for a smaller squash which will be less watery than really large ones. Look for firm skin without blemishes.
